Why Kalai (Tin Lining) is Essential for Ghee
Pure brass reacts with acidic and dairy components if left uncoated. The traditional Kalai process applies a food-grade, non-reactive tin barrier on the vessel interior, protecting the purity, aroma, and delicate taste of fresh cow ghee while preserving the natural antibacterial benefits of heavy metal cookware.

Natural Care & Cleaning Instructions
- Hand Wash Only: Wash gently with mild dish soap and a soft sponge. Never clean in a dishwasher or use abrasive steel wool.
- Exterior Brass Polish: To restore the exterior brass shine, apply a gentle paste of natural lemon juice and salt or Pitambari powder, rub lightly on the brass outer surface, rinse with clean water, and immediately wipe dry with a soft microfiber cloth.
- Preserving the Kalai: Do not scrub the silver-toned tin lining with harsh abrasives; a gentle soapy rinse is all that is required.
